package org.apache.commons.imaging.formats.jpeg.segments;
import static org.apache.commons.imaging.common.BinaryFunctions.read2Bytes;
import static org.apache.commons.imaging.common.BinaryFunctions.readByte;
import java.io.ByteArrayInputStream;
import java.io.IOException;
import java.io.InputStream;
import java.util.ArrayList;
import java.util.List;
import org.apache.commons.imaging.ImagingException;
/**
* A JPEG DQT (Define Quantization Table) segment.
*/
public final class DqtSegment extends AbstractSegment {
/**
* A quantization table for JPEG compression.
*/
public static class QuantizationTable {
/** The precision of the quantization table (0=8-bit, 1=16-bit). */
public final int precision;
/** The destination identifier. */
public final int destinationIdentifier;
private final int[] elements;
/**
* Constructs a new quantization table.
*
* @param precision the precision (0=8-bit, 1=16-bit).
* @param destinationIdentifier the destination identifier.
* @param elements the quantization table elements.
*/
public QuantizationTable(final int precision, final int destinationIdentifier, final int[] elements) {
this.precision = precision;
this.destinationIdentifier = destinationIdentifier;
this.elements = elements;
}
/**
* Gets the quantization table elements.
*
* @return the elements.
*/
public int[] getElements() {
return elements;
}
}
/** The list of quantization tables in this segment. */
public final List<QuantizationTable> quantizationTables = new ArrayList<>();
/**
* Constructs a DQT segment from segment data.
*
* @param marker the segment marker.
* @param segmentData the segment data.
* @throws ImagingException if the image format is invalid.
* @throws IOException if an I/O error occurs.
*/
public DqtSegment(final int marker, final byte[] segmentData) throws ImagingException, IOException {
this(marker, segmentData.length, new ByteArrayInputStream(segmentData));
}
/**
* Constructs a DQT segment by reading from an input stream.
*
* @param marker the segment marker.
* @param length the segment length.
* @param is the input stream to read from.
* @throws ImagingException if the image format is invalid.
* @throws IOException if an I/O error occurs.
*/
public DqtSegment(final int marker, int length, final InputStream is) throws ImagingException, IOException {
super(marker, length);
while (length > 0) {
final int precisionAndDestination = readByte("QuantizationTablePrecisionAndDestination", is, "Not a Valid JPEG File");
length--;
final int precision = precisionAndDestination >> 4 & 0xf;
final int destinationIdentifier = precisionAndDestination & 0xf;
final int[] elements = new int[64];
for (int i = 0; i < 64; i++) {
if (precision == 0) {
elements[i] = 0xff & readByte("QuantizationTableElement", is, "Not a Valid JPEG File");
length--;
} else if (precision == 1) {
elements[i] = read2Bytes("QuantizationTableElement", is, "Not a Valid JPEG File", getByteOrder());
length -= 2;
} else {
throw new ImagingException("Quantization table precision '" + precision + "' is invalid");
}
}
quantizationTables.add(new QuantizationTable(precision, destinationIdentifier, elements));
}
}
@Override
public String getDescription() {
return "DQT (" + getSegmentType() + ")";
}
}
